Wickedly Welsh Chocolate win two product listings across 56 ALDI stores in Wales

Karen and Mark Owen - co-founders

An independent Welsh chocolatier has secured a listing for two of its products across all 56 ALDI stores in Wales. This comes after the chocolate brand scored highly during a consumer focussed supplier event held in Swansea and organised by the supermarket.

Wickedly Welsh Chocolate will now be supplying its 90-gram Salted Caramel and Milk Chocolate bars to the 56 ALDI stores after the supermarket supplier event saw the products so highly rated.

The product scoring was across areas such as flavour, taste, pricing and likely frequency of purchase, with over 16,000 pieces of data being recorded during the event. The products can now be found on ALDI’s shelves by.

The ALDI listing is the latest success for Wickedly Welsh Chocolate and expands its list of stockists, as products can be found in the likes of Fortnum and Mason and Co-op (Wales).
